New Delhi, March 15 -- Since the launch of the Delhi EV policy in August 2020, 630 new two-wheelers have been registered. It is registering more, the Delhi government said in a statement. But in a forward-moving statement, Transport Minister Kailash Gahlot said that in six months, all leased, hired cars for the commute of Delhi Government officials will be electric vehicles. The campaign by the Delhi government aims to sensitise people about the benefits of switching to EVs. It further aims to make them aware of the incentives and infrastructure for EV.
